Does anyone know if a 180 gallon with a metal stand can be keep on a second floor with no problem?

My floors are wooden but thats under like layers of linoleum, hahahaha.
I wouild like to put the tank in my bed room against a wall that divids my room and the living room wood that work. I have been planning on getting a 180 and now I have made my mind up and will be getting one in the month of August or September.
 
had a 220 and a 110 both on the same floor across from each other for 3 yrs straight until now I have the 400gallon in the garage at my new place just do it
 
The best placement of your tank is perpendicular to the floor joists. I would not place a 180g parallel to the floor joist, bad things may happen.

I would be careful in how you set it up. 2000 pounds in one relatively small area can do damage over time to flooring if not properly reinforced.

from what I have read on this forum, many people who put large tanks (over 125g) on second floors add additional floor joists to beef up the floor before they set up the tank..
